Utilizing Artificial Intelligence to Anticipate Animal Migratory Routes

Animal migration is a fascinating phenomenon that has enthralled scientists for centuries. Conventional methods of tracking these movements often prove to be laborious, restrictive in their scope, and pricey. Yet, the advent of artificial intelligence (AI) offers a revolutionary approach to understanding and predicting animal migratory patterns. AI algorithms can process vast datasets collected from various sources, such as GPS tracking devices, camera traps, and citizen science observations. By recognizing trends within this information, AI can create reliable estimates of future migratory routes and timings. This has the potential to revolutionize our knowledge of animal migration, enabling us to better safeguard vulnerable species and their habitats.

Animal Migration Mapping with AI-Driven Analytical Techniques

AI-driven predictive analytics is revolutionizing our understanding of animal migration. By analyzing vast datasets of historical movement patterns, environmental factors, and other relevant indicators, sophisticated algorithms can forecast future migration routes and behavior. This powerful technology provides invaluable insights for conservation efforts, enabling researchers to pinpoint critical habitats, mitigate human-wildlife conflict, and ultimately safeguard vulnerable species.
